Test Statistic
A calculated value used in hypothesis testing that helps to determine whether to reject the null hypothesis.
Pooled Variance
Pooled variance is a method used to estimate the variance of two or more groups by combining their variances, assuming they have the same variance but not necessarily the same mean.
